A plan that sets a long-term vision and says what business the organisation is in is a:
AStartup plan
BStrategic plan
CStraight plan
DStandard plan
Answer & Solution
Correct answer: B. Strategic plan
1. The horizon here is years, not weeks.
2. It covers the whole organisation and its place in the world.
3. That is a strategic plan.
